A little bugfix release: 1.2.1
25 07 2007It’s always good if you don’t have too push out bugfix releases all too often, but once in a while it becomes necessary.
This time, we’re fixing two very rare hangs that could happen when stopping a profile or when heavy traffic is flowing over the router. Additionally, we’ve further reduced Lighthouse’s CPU and memory footprint while increasing its overall snappiness.
On the UPnP front, we no longer require routers to support the retrieval of the external IP address in order for Lighthouse to associate. If the router doesn’t support this, but port forwardings work fine, Lighthouse will happily associate with such routers now and simply report the external IP address as “Unknown”. This should increase Lighthouse’s overall UPnP compatibility and make it work on some previously unsupported models.
Also, we’ve found a weird bug in some recent Netgear firmware that prevented Lighthouse from associating with the affected models. However, we were able to come up with a workaround that solves the problem until Netgear releases a fix. If you have a Netgear router with the latest firmware, but couldn’t get Lighthouse to run, we suggest that you retry with 1.2.1.
